It is located at a longitude of 17˚ 55” to 18˚30” N and latitude of 120˚55” to 121˚10’ E. The municipality is bounded by the following:
North = Municipality of Claveria, province of Cagayan
Northeast = Municipality of Sanchez Mira of Cagayan
Northwest = Municipality Adams, province of Ilocos Norte
South = Municipality of Kabugao, province of Apayao
Southeast = Municipality of Luna, province of
Apayao
Southwest = Municipality of Solsona, province of Ilocos Norte
East = Municipality of Luna, province of Apayao
West = Municipality of Carasi, province of Ilocos Norte
At the western and southwestern part of the municipality, the municipal boundary is delineated by a part of the Cordillera Mountain Range while at the Northern and northeastern portions starting from San Miguel, a sitio of barangay Cadongdongan which is a barangay of Sta. Tomas of Barangay Malilit-ao of Claveria, Cagayan, the boundary is delineated by boundary monuments put up by the Carteza Cadastral Survey Team which conducted the Cadastral Survey through the official act of the officials of Claveria municipality. To the heart of the municipality there is only one vehicular access road and that is the 80 km Claveria-Calanasan vehicular road. The on-going Solsona-Kabugao road which passes through barangay Butao which is one of the barangays of the municipality also provides access indirectly for visiting commuters and travelers who either come from Kabugao of from the Ilocos towns. Calanasan can also be reached from Kabuagao by the use of motor-powered flat bottom boats. Calanasan is 56 kilometers from the capital town of Kabugao, 80 kilometers away from the town of Claveria, Cagayan, 220 kms from Laoag City, 520 kms from Baguio City, and 360 kms from Tuguegarao City.
